Learn MoreOne of the largest growth opportunities in gastroenterology today is screening awareness. Many newly eligible patients are unaware of current screening recommendations, while others delay over concerns about prep, cost, or anxiety. Effective campaigns address these directly. Practices that address these concerns directly often see stronger screening participation and increased procedure volume.
Most screening campaigns focus on awareness. The Highest-Performing Ones Focus on Scheduling. Patients often understand the importance of screening but delay taking action. Reducing scheduling friction is often more impactful than increasing awareness alone.
